Virgin River fans ‘work out’ major Mike and Brie split twist with glaring season 7 clue

Virgin River enthusiasts are abuzz with theories that one of the beloved couples might be heading for splitsville in the upcoming seventh season.

The Netflix sensation, which saw its thrilling sixth season finale last year, left viewers swooning over Mel Monroe (portrayed by Alexandra Breckenridge) and Jack Sheridan’s (Martin Henderson) idyllic yet dramatic wedding.

Amidst the nuptials, Mel had an emotional reunion with her biological father, Everett Reid (John Allen Nelson), while Jack’s sister Brie (Zibby Allen) found herself entangled in a love triangle involving her troubled ex Dan Brady (Benjamin Hollingsworth) and new flame Mike Valenzuela (Marco Grazzini).

Brie ended things with Brady due to his deceit about his criminal past and embarked on a romance with detective Mike, as Brady got involved with local Lark (Elise Gatien).

The plot took another twist when Brady learnt that Lark was conspiring with Jimmy (Ian Tracey) to dupe him, and amidst this chaos, Mike seized the moment to propose at Mel and Jack’s wedding.

Adding fuel to the fire, Brie and Brady had previously shared a clandestine tryst, leading legions of fans to believe they’re bound to rekindle their passion in the next instalment.

Avid watchers have now unearthed a telling sign that Mike and Brie’s relationship is doomed, thanks to a fresh face joining the cast for season seven.

One eagle-eyed fan speculated on Reddit: “Brady will ask for Brie and Mike’s help to go after Lark.

“The lawyer going after Doc (Tim Matheson) and Mike will get close (from what I’ve read they knew each other from the past and she is a love interest).

“Mike sees how Brady and Brie interact constantly and realize he always comes second so breaks it off with her (who may initially say yes to the proposal).”

While ardent admirers of Virgin River are almost convinced that Brie will agree to Mike’s romantic proposition, the entrance of Sara Canning as Victoria—a medical board investigator—could cause a major disruption.

The official character outline, disclosed in March, proclaims: “Sara Canning joins the cast as ex-cop Victoria, who was shot in the line of duty and now works for the state medical board as an investigator.

“Victoria comes to Virgin River to look into Doc’s practice but runs into a friend she wouldn’t mind catching up with … or maybe even pursuing

Although producers are tight-lipped, it’s hinted that the ‘friend’ mentioned is likely to be Mike, who previously collaborated with Victoria before her career-altering incident.

All eyes are on season seven to see whether Brie and Brady’s relationship will withstand the situation when Mike’s former colleague—and potential flame—arrives in town.
